About Mikael Nilsson
Mikael Nilsson is a scholar working on Filtration and Separation, Physical and Theoretical Chemistry, Geology, Computational Mechanics and Computer Vision and Pattern Recognition, having authored 29 papers that have together received 908 indexed citations. Recurring topics across this work include Vehicular Ad Hoc Networks (VANETs) (6 papers), Millimeter-Wave Propagation and Modeling (5 papers), Power Line Communications and Noise (5 papers), Field-Flow Fractionation Techniques (4 papers), thermodynamics and calorimetric analyses (4 papers), Diabetes and associated disorders (3 papers), Electromagnetic Compatibility and Measurements (3 papers) and Electromagnetic Compatibility and Noise Suppression (2 papers). The work is most often cited by research in Physiology (250 citations), Cell Biology (144 citations), Endocrinology, Diabetes and Metabolism (146 citations), Nutrition and Dietetics (94 citations) and Computational Mechanics (106 citations). Mikael Nilsson has collaborated with scholars based in Sweden, United States and Denmark. Frequent co-authors include Inger Björck, Anders Frid, Jens J. Holst, M. Stenberg, Fredrik Tufvesson, Taimoor Abbas, Karl‐Gustav Wahlund, Leif Bülow, Carl Gustafson and Göran Hallmans. Their work appears in journals such as Journal of Internal Medicine, IEEE Transactions on Vehicular Technology, Biotechnology and Bioengineering, European Journal of Clinical Nutrition and IEEE Transactions on Industrial Electronics.
